Sky News host Alan Jones reviewed the recent Wimbledon Women’s Finals, saying that Australian Ash Barty acted with dignity, integrity, courage and humility, and he certainly belongs to ” Our best chronicle”.
In a recent three-set thriller against Karolína Plíšková in the Czech Republic, Ash Barty won the women’s final and became Australia’s first Wimbledon champion in four years.
After an easy first set, the 25-year-old Queensland star was asked to compete for the coveted title in the second set.
Ms. Batty won the game 6-3, 6-7, 6-3.
“Ash, you not only won on Saturday, but you also confirmed your status as the best player in the world; Mr. Jones said: “You not only showed skill, but also had a sound temperament, but also showed dignity, integrity, courage and humility. “
